一种空压机余热回收装置
By combining serpentine heat exchange tubes and electromagnetic switching valves, and utilizing heat flow meters and PLC controllers, the waste heat of the air compressor can be adjusted in real time, solving the problem of unstable heating temperature in the waste heat recovery device of the air compressor, and improving the heating effect and applicability.

Claims
1. A waste heat recovery device for an air compressor, comprising a recovery tank (1), characterized in that: The recycling box (1) is provided with multiple recycling chambers (2) inside. The top of the recycling box (1) is detachably provided with a box cover (3) that seals the top of the multiple recycling chambers (2). Each recycling chamber (2) is fixedly provided with a serpentine heat exchange tube (4). The upper end of each serpentine heat exchange tube (4) extends to the top of the box cover (3) and is fixedly provided with an electromagnetic switch valve (5). A hollow air inlet plate (6) is detachably provided on the top of the box cover (3). The lower surface of the hollow air inlet plate (6) is sealed and inserted into the upper end of the multiple serpentine heat exchange tubes (4). An air inlet pipe (7) is fixedly provided on the upper surface of the hollow air inlet plate (6), and a heat flow meter (8) is fixedly provided on the pipe wall of the air inlet pipe (7). The recycling bin (1) is fixedly provided with an inlet pipe (9) and an outlet pipe (10) on all four sides of the recycling bin (1) and at the positions corresponding to each recycling chamber (2). The inlet pipe (9) is located at the top of the recycling bin (1) and the outlet pipe (10) is located at the bottom of the recycling bin (1). The bottom of the recycling box (1) is fixedly provided with a filter box (11), and the lower end of each of the serpentine heat exchange tubes (4) extends into the interior of the filter box (11). The bottom of the side wall of the filter box (11) is fixedly provided with an exhaust pipe (12).
2. The air compressor waste heat recovery device according to claim 1, characterized by: A rubber sealing sleeve (13) is fixedly provided on the lower surface of the hollow air inlet plate (6). The upper end of the serpentine heat exchange tube (4) is inserted into the inside of the rubber sealing sleeve (13). A rubber sealing ring (14) is fixedly provided on the upper wall of the serpentine heat exchange tube (4). The upper end of the serpentine heat exchange tube (4) and the box cover (3) are sealed together by the rubber sealing ring (14).
3. The air compressor waste heat recovery device according to claim 1, characterized by: Both sides of the recycling bin (1) and the lid (3) are provided with first connecting parts (15), and the two ends of the first connecting parts (15) are fixedly connected to the recycling bin (1) and the lid (3) by a first bolt group.
4. The air compressor waste heat recovery device according to claim 1, characterized by: The box cover (3) and the hollow air intake plate (6) are provided with second connecting parts (16) on both sides, and the two ends of the second connecting parts (16) are fixedly connected to the box cover (3) and the hollow air intake plate (6) by the second bolt group.
5. The air compressor waste heat recovery device of claim 1, wherein: The filter box (11) is fixedly provided with a filter screen (17) and an activated carbon filter layer (18). The filter screen (17) is located above the activated carbon filter layer (18). The side wall of the filter box (11) is provided with a sealing door panel (19).
6. The air compressor waste heat recovery device of claim 1, wherein: The recycling bin (1) is fixedly equipped with a PLC controller (20) on its side wall. The electromagnetic switch valve (5) and the heat flow meter (8) are both electrically connected to the PLC controller (20).
